Some of Randy’s teams were stacked especially on Offense
Some of these guys haven’t made an impact but others are starters in the NFL.

RB –Mike James, Lamar Miller and Storm Johnson
WR – Hankerson, Byrd, Benjamin, Hurns
OL – Linder, Gunn, Henderson, Washington
On D - Allen Bailey,Ray Ray, Vernon, DVD, Brandon Harris, Ojomo, Forston

Not to say that was a Championship team but this team should have won more than they did.
